A series of specially commissioned films today to mark the Commonwealth Games handover ceremony in Delhi.

The six films, collectively entitled Walls of Light, have been made by internationally-renowned Scottish artists Calum Stirling, Henry Coombes, Katri Walker, Alex Hetherington, Stina Wirfelt and Clara Ursitti, and tell the stories of ordinary and extraordinary Scots in the world of sporting endeavour.

These filmswere commissioned by CCA to mark the beginning of Glasgow’s tenure as hst of the 2014 Commonwealth Games.

They explore the ways in which artists can respond to sport in its broadest sense, as well as the social and cultural impact of the games on the city and its people.
